Transaction 03b89d7d5c67baedfb38d273bba4b6938741a7a599564821140918500318fe58
1 Input
1 Output
-
03b89d7d5c67baedfb38d273bba4b6938741a7a599564821140918500318fe58:0
- value
- 27816083
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2a65e49ee5b9f13602b3736b34e74d6479f31e07 OP_EQUAL
- address
- 35ZCNFg98hUVwmRPmijUp684fvwizN6aTf